A typical reason that a citizen in the Hills District may call a Level 2 Electrician is to improve their electrical power system, such as moving from single-phase to three-phase electrical energy. With reliance on high-power devices like central air conditioning, electrical automobile battery chargers, and big swimming pool modern Hills District homes, the original electrical lots of older houses is no longer adequate. A Level 2 Electrician Hills District essential abilities and authority to upgrade the main consumer power lines and set up the needed systems to manage these increased electrical needs. This task is complex and demands an extensive understanding of and network guidelines to prevent straining the regional transformer. Furthermore, only a Level 2 Electrician in the Hills District is authorized to set up or boost advanced metering gadgets, necessary for property owners who want to include solar panels into their energy setup. By guaranteeing a strong connection in between the home and the electricity grid, a Level 2 Electrician in the Hills District develops a solid basis for energy effectiveness and lasting dependability in a contemporary Australian home
Security stays the paramount issue when dealing with high-voltage electrical energy, and a Hills District Level 2 Electrician functions as the primary secure versus hazardous network flaws. It is not unusual for homeowner to receive a defect notice from their network provider, indicating that their private power pole is decomposing or their overhead service line is drooping dangerously low. In such instances, just a qualified Hills District Level 2 Electrician can remedy the problem and release the necessary Certificate of Compliance for Electrical Work (CCEW) to clear the notice. These professionals are geared up with specialised machinery, including raised work platforms and high-precision testing tools, to handle live wires without endangering the surrounding community. Beyond reactive repair work, a proactive Hills District Level 2 Electrician can perform comprehensive inspections of a residential or commercial property's switchboard, replacing out-of-date ceramic merges with contemporary circuit breakers and recurring existing gadgets. This level of preventative upkeep is particularly essential in the leafier suburbs of the Hills, where falling branches or high winds can put immense physical pressure on the electrical connection points that a Hills District Level 2 Electrician is trained to safeguard.
The distinctions between a standard electrician and a specialized Hills District Level 2 Electrician become more noticable when dealing with the intricacies of underground electrical infrastructure. In the Hills District, numerous contemporary domestic advancements include underground power lines to boost their visual appeal and lessen the possibility of power failures brought on by weather and other external factors. A Hills District Level 2 Electrician carries out the complicated process of excavating, laying conduits, and establishing connections to the street's power pillar, thus making sure a reputable and hid power supply to the home. This specific work requires particular certifications that fall under the Class 2B and 2C classifications, setting them apart from general electricians.
